* { margin:0; padding:0;}
body{ background:#ffffff;}
html, input, textarea, select{font-family:Arial, tahoma, verdana; font-size:12px; color:#636363;}

/*in_line*/
input, select { vertical-align:middle; font-weight:normal;}
img {border:0; vertical-align:top; text-align:left;}
ul { list-style:none;}


strong a{ color:#D58905;  background:url(images/marker.gif) no-repeat left top; background-position:0 3px; padding-left:17px; text-decoration:underline;}
strong a:hover{ text-decoration:none}

a:hover{text-decoration:none;}
a {color:#609700;}
span a {color:#609700;}
span{ color:#58ba23;}



.column { float:left;}
.clear { clear:both;}
.picture{float:left; margin: 0 19px 25px 0;}


#header{ background:url(images/header_wrapper.jpg) top left no-repeat; width:780px; }
#header .col_1{ width:300px;}
#header .col_1 img{ margin:22px 0 0 36px;}
#header .col_2{ width:480px; padding-top:17px;}

/*footer*/
#footer{ text-align:center; padding:0 0 40px 0; color:#636363; font-size:12px;}
#footer a{ color:#8eba23;}

/*content*/
.main_height_cont{ width:37px; float:left;}
.col_content{ width:780px; float:left; background:#FFFFFF;}
.right_border{ width:23px; float:left;}
.title{ background:url(images/title_wr.gif) bottom left repeat-x; height:26px;}
.title1{ display:block;}


#content h1 { color:#D58905; padding: 0 0 0px 0px; font-size:12pt }
#content h2 { color:#D58905; padding: 0 0 7px 5px; font-size:12pt }
#content h3 { color:#D58905; padding: 15px 0 7px 0; font-size:12pt }
#content h4 { color:#D58905;  background:url(images/delete_16x16.jpg) no-repeat left top; padding: 0 0 7px 20px; font-size:12pt}
#content h5 { color:#D58905;  background:url(images/smile_24x24.jpg) no-repeat left top; padding: 0 0 20px 30px; font-size:12pt}
#content h6 { color:#D58905;  background:url(images/warning_24x24.jpg) no-repeat left top; padding: 0 0 20px 30px; font-size:12pt}

#content .noteBox h2 { color:#D58905;  background:url(images/notes.gif) no-repeat left top; padding: 3px 0 7px 30px; font-size:12pt}
#content .noteBox table { margin-top:5px; margin-left:-5px;}

#content .ownerBox h2 { color:#D58905;  background:url(images/owner.gif) no-repeat left top; padding: 3px 0 7px 30px; font-size:12pt}
#content .ownerBox table { margin-top:5px; margin-left:-5px;}

#content .upcomingBox h2 { color:#D58905; font-size:12pt}
#content .upcomingBox h3 { color:#D58905; font-size:12pt; padding: 25px 0 0 0; margin-bottom:-5px;}
#content .upcomingBox ul { list-style:disc; padding-left:12px;}


#content .linkBox h2 { color:#D58905;  background:url(images/links.gif) no-repeat left top; padding: 3px 0 7px 30px; font-size:12pt; margin-bottom:-10px;}

#content table td {vertical-align:top; padding:5px;}
#content {min-height:400px; }
#content .note { color:#8eba23; font-style:italic; }
#sheet table td{padding: 4px 2px;}

#content .bookTime {text-align:right; font-weight:bold; }
#content .bookInfo { border: 1px solid #cccccc; background:#f0f0f0; width:100%; padding-left:5px;}
#content .bookInfo table{margin-top:-2px; margin-bottom:-15px;}
#content .bookInfo table td{padding: 0 2px; vertical-align:top;}
#content .bookInfo ul { list-style:disc; padding-left:20px;}

#content .modInfo ul { list-style:disc; padding-left:12px;}

#content .siteInfo ul { list-style:disc; padding-left:12px;}
#content .siteInfo h3 { color:#D58905; padding: 15px 0 0px 0; font-size:12pt }

/*================== side bar left ==================*/
#sbLeft #content .height{ width:30px; float:left; height:489px;}

#sbLeft #content .col_1{padding:17px 0 34px 0;}
#sbLeft #content .col_1 .title{ margin-bottom:1px;}
#sbLeft #content .col_1 .title1{ margin-bottom:1px;}
#sbLeft #content .col_1 .indent_box{ padding:1px 16px 20px 20px;}
#sbLeft #content .col_1 .indent_img{ margin:15px 0;}
#sbLeft #content .col_1 ul{ margin:16px 0 11px 0;}

#sbLeft #content .col_2{padding:17px 0 34px 0;}
#sbLeft #content .col_2 .title1{ margin-bottom:1px;}
#sbLeft #content .col_2 .indent_box{ padding:1px 16px 20px 20px;}
#sbLeft #content .col_2 .indent_img{ margin:15px 0;}
#sbLeft #content .col_2 ul{ margin:16px 0 11px 0;}


/*================== side bar right ==================*/
#sbRight #content .height{ width:30px; float:left; height:489px;}

#sbRight #content .col_1{padding:17px 0 34px 0;}
#sbRight #content .col_1 .title{ margin-bottom:1px;}
#sbRight #content .col_1 .title1{ margin-bottom:1px;}
#sbRight #content .col_1 .indent_box{ padding:1px 16px 20px 20px;}
#sbRight #content .col_1 ul{ margin:16px 0 11px 0;}

#sbRight #content .col_2{padding:17px 0 34px 0;}
#sbRight #content .col_2 .title1{ margin-bottom:1px;}
#sbRight #content .col_2 .indent_box{ padding:1px 16px 20px 20px;}
#sbRight #content .col_2 .indent_img{ margin:15px 0;}
#sbRight #content .col_2 ul{ margin:16px 0 11px 0;}


/*================== no side bar ==================*/
#sbNo #content .height{ width:30px; float:left; height:489px;}

#sbNo #content .col_1{padding:17px 0 34px 0; margin-right:30px; }
#sbNo #content .col_1 .title{ margin-bottom:1px;}
#sbNo #content .col_1 .title1{ margin-bottom:1px;}
#sbNo #content .col_1 .indent_box{ padding:1px 16px 20px 20px;}
#sbNo #content .col_1 .indent_img{ margin:15px 0;}
#sbNo #content .col_1 ul{ margin:16px 0 11px 0;}


/*==================list====================*/
.block { margin-bottom:15px; }
.block .t { background:url(images/m2-t-dr.gif) repeat-x top #FFFFFF;}
.block .b { background:url(images/m2-t-dr.gif) repeat-x bottom;}
.block .l { background:url(images/m2-t-dr.gif) repeat-y left;}
.block .r { background:url(images/m2-t-dr.gif) repeat-y right;}
.block .l_t { background:url(images/m2-l-t.gif) no-repeat left top;}
.block .r_t { background:url(images/m2-r-t.gif) no-repeat right top;}
.block .l_b { background:url(images/m2-l-b.gif) no-repeat left bottom;}
.block .r_b { background:url(images/m2-r-b.gif) no-repeat right bottom; width:100%;}

.block1 { width:100%;}
.block1 .t1 { background:url(images/m2-t-dr1.gif) repeat-x top #f0f0f0;}
.block1 .l_t1 { background:url(images/m2-l-t1.gif) no-repeat left top;}
.block1 .r_t1 { background:url(images/m2-r-t1.gif) no-repeat right top;}
.block1 .l_b1 { background:url(images/m2-l-b1.gif) no-repeat left bottom;}
.block1 .r_b1 { background:url(images/m2-r-b1.gif) no-repeat right bottom;}


.row_top .list li a {background:url(images/list_bull.gif) center left no-repeat; margin:0; padding:0 0 0 14px; line-height:16px; color:#a0a0a0;}

li a { background:url(images/list_bull_1.gif) center left no-repeat; margin:0; padding:0 0 0 15px; line-height:20px; color:#2372a7;}

#noStyle li a { background:#ffffff; margin:0; padding:0; color:#609700; }

/*==========================================*/


